Description
Anecdotal report (resulting from a conversation between John Day of the East Dorset Antiquarian Society and Mr K Box of Holt, a builder) of the finding of hundreds of broken clay pipes at basement level during building works in the 1970s. The pipes were covered up by the builders.
In 1997 the building was used by the Department of Health and Social Security. The site location at present is the central point of the lane.
